Dependent type theory is having a moment as the foundation for interactive provers, such as Lean, Rocq, and Agda. But what does dependent type theory offer to programmers, who just want to get work done? While Haskell is not a full spectrum dependently-typed language, its type system draws inspiration from its features, and provides a playground for experimentation.

In this talk, I will use the “rebound” library to demonstrate and reflect on the current capabilities of dependently-typed programming in Haskell. This library supports working with well-scoped de Bruijn indices in abstract syntax trees. Because ASTs statically track their scope depths, type checking program transformations ensures that scopes are properly maintained, a source of subtle bugs in language implementation.
